567,850 is a composite number, even.
567,850 (five hundred sixty-seven thousand eight hundred fifty) is an even 6-digit number. It is a composite number with 24 divisors, and factors as 2 × 5² × 41 × 277. Written other ways, in hexadecimal, 0x8AA2A.
